On the W126, the lower ball joints, regardless of brand, need a press to install them. IIRC, someone here on the forum made the press from an auto parts store work. But it was with a little finagling and using it "backwards". Another, purchased a mandrel with a special cut out.

Personally, I took mine to an indy who had the press. Cost ~$10 and 5 min. of time.

Also, I think a ball joint press is available in the forum tool rental program.
